Management assertions or financial statement assertions are the implicit or explicit assertions that the preparer of financial statements ( management) is making to its users. These assertions are relevant to auditors performing a financial statement audit in two ways. Web18 jan. 2024 · A compliance audit gauges how well an organization adheres to rules and regulations, standards, and even internal bylaws and codes of conduct. Part of an audit may also review the effectiveness of an organization’s internal controls. Different departments may use multiple types of audits.
